Book Description
Book Two of the award-winning series, THE PROFESSIONALS!

The dangerous criminal mastermind Mr. Who is still out there

...and thousands of convicts are escaping from prisons all over the country.

But all Quenton Cohen cares about is opening his own restaurant and appearing on his favorite TV show, Chef of Steel - even if that means turning his back on... More
